In today’s data-driven world, the ability to efficiently integrate and transform data is critical for businesses of all sizes. SQL Server Integration Services (SSIS) 950 is a powerful tool that has revolutionized the landscape of data integration and transformation.
This comprehensive guide delves into the features, benefits, and applications of SSIS 950, providing insights that go beyond what’s available online. We’ll explore the technical capabilities, practical applications, and best practices for using SSIS 950, aiming to offer a resource that ranks highly in search engine results and serves the needs of a US-based audience.
What is SSIS 950?
SSIS 950, short for SQL Server Integration Services version 950, is an advanced data integration tool designed by Microsoft. It is part of the SQL Server suite and is used for data migration, integration, and transformation tasks. SSIS 950 enables users to extract, transform, and load (ETL) data from various sources into a destination database, facilitating seamless data flow and integration across different systems.
Key Features of SSIS 950
Advanced Data Transformation Capabilities
One of the standout features of SSIS 950 is its advanced data transformation capabilities. It allows users to perform complex data transformations with ease, including data cleansing, data aggregation, and data validation. These transformations are essential for ensuring data quality and consistency across different systems.
Integration with Various Data Sources
SSIS 950 supports integration with a wide range of data sources, including SQL Server, Oracle, MySQL, Excel, flat files, and more. This versatility makes it an ideal choice for organizations with diverse data environments.
Scalability and Performance
SSIS 950 is designed to handle large volumes of data efficiently. Its scalable architecture ensures high performance even when processing massive datasets. This scalability is crucial for businesses that deal with big data and need to perform ETL operations on a large scale.
User-Friendly Interface
SSIS 950 features a user-friendly interface that allows both technical and non-technical users to design and manage ETL processes. The drag-and-drop functionality simplifies the creation of data workflows, making it accessible to a broad range of users.
Error Handling and Logging
Effective error handling and logging are critical for maintaining data integrity and diagnosing issues. SSIS 950 provides robust error handling mechanisms and detailed logging capabilities, allowing users to identify and resolve errors quickly.
Benefits of Using SSIS 950
Improved Data Quality
By leveraging the data transformation capabilities of SSIS 950, organizations can ensure that their data is accurate, consistent, and reliable. Data cleansing and validation processes help eliminate errors and inconsistencies, resulting in higher data quality.
Enhanced Productivity
The user-friendly interface and automation features of SSIS 950 enable users to design and execute ETL processes more efficiently. This increased productivity allows organizations to focus on more strategic tasks rather than manual data integration efforts.
Cost-Effective Solution
SSIS 950 offers a cost-effective solution for data integration and transformation. Its integration with the SQL Server suite means that organizations can leverage existing infrastructure, reducing the need for additional investments in third-party tools.
Flexibility and Adaptability
The versatility of SSIS 950 in handling various data sources and performing complex transformations makes it a flexible and adaptable tool. Organizations can easily adjust their ETL processes to meet changing business requirements.
Practical Applications of SSIS 950
Data Warehousing
SSIS 950 is widely used in data warehousing projects to extract data from operational databases, transform it into a suitable format, and load it into a data warehouse. This process is essential for creating a centralized repository of data that supports business intelligence and analytics.
Data Migration
Organizations often need to migrate data from legacy systems to modern platforms. SSIS 950 simplifies the data migration process by providing tools for extracting, transforming, and loading data between different systems.
Data Integration for Reporting
Accurate and timely reporting requires data from multiple sources to be integrated and transformed. SSIS 950 enables organizations to consolidate data from various systems, ensuring that reports are based on comprehensive and up-to-date information.
Master Data Management
Maintaining consistent and accurate master data is crucial for organizations. SSIS 950 supports master data management initiatives by providing tools for data cleansing, matching, and consolidation, ensuring that master data is accurate and reliable.
Real-Time Data Processing
In addition to batch processing, SSIS 950 also supports real-time data processing. This capability is essential for applications that require immediate data integration and transformation, such as real-time analytics and monitoring systems.
Best Practices for Using SSIS 950
Design Efficient ETL Processes
Efficiency is key when designing ETL processes with SSIS 950. Use best practices such as minimizing data movement, reducing the number of transformations, and optimizing data flow to ensure high performance.
Implement Robust Error Handling
Effective error handling is crucial for maintaining data integrity. Design ETL processes with comprehensive error handling mechanisms, including logging, notifications, and retries, to ensure that errors are detected and resolved promptly.
Monitor and Optimize Performance
Regularly monitor the performance of your SSIS 950 packages and identify any bottlenecks or performance issues. Use performance optimization techniques, such as indexing, partitioning, and parallel processing, to enhance the efficiency of your ETL processes.
Maintain Documentation
Maintain thorough documentation of your SSIS 950 packages, including data sources, transformations, and workflows. Documentation helps in understanding and maintaining ETL processes, especially when multiple team members are involved.
Leverage Community and Support Resources
Take advantage of the extensive community and support resources available for SSIS 950. Participate in forums, attend webinars, and consult official documentation to stay updated on best practices and new features.
Future Trends and Innovations in SSIS 950
Integration with Cloud Services
As more organizations adopt cloud technologies, SSIS 950 is expected to enhance its integration with cloud services such as Azure and AWS. This integration will enable seamless data movement between on-premises and cloud environments.
Advanced Analytics and Machine Learning
The integration of advanced analytics and machine learning capabilities into SSIS 950 will open new possibilities for data transformation and analysis. Organizations will be able to leverage these capabilities to gain deeper insights from their data.
Enhanced Security and Compliance
With growing concerns about data security and compliance, future versions of SSIS 950 are likely to include enhanced security features and compliance tools. These enhancements will help organizations protect sensitive data and meet regulatory requirements.
AI-Driven Data Integration
Artificial intelligence (AI) is poised to revolutionize data integration by automating complex tasks and providing intelligent recommendations. SSIS 950 is expected to incorporate AI-driven features that simplify ETL processes and improve data quality.
FAQs about SSIS 950
What is SSIS 950 used for?
SSIS 950 is used for data integration, transformation, and migration tasks. It enables organizations to extract data from various sources, transform it into a suitable format, and load it into a destination database.
How does SSIS 950 improve data quality?
SSIS 950 improves data quality through its advanced data transformation capabilities, including data cleansing, validation, and aggregation. These processes ensure that data is accurate, consistent, and reliable.
Is SSIS 950 suitable for real-time data processing?
Yes, SSIS 950 supports real-time data processing, making it suitable for applications that require immediate data integration and transformation, such as real-time analytics and monitoring systems.
Can SSIS 950 integrate with cloud services?
Yes, SSIS 950 can integrate with various cloud services, including Azure and AWS. This integration enables seamless data movement between on-premises and cloud environments.
What are the key benefits of using SSIS 950?
The key benefits of using SSIS 950 include improved data quality, enhanced productivity, cost-effectiveness, flexibility, and scalability. These benefits make SSIS 950 a powerful tool for data integration and transformation.
Conclusion
SSIS 950 is a game-changer in the field of data integration and transformation. Its advanced features, scalability, and user-friendly interface make it an essential tool for organizations looking to streamline their data processes and gain valuable insights from their data.
By leveraging the capabilities of SSIS 950, businesses can improve data quality, enhance productivity, and achieve greater flexibility in their data integration efforts. As the landscape of data integration continues to evolve, SSIS 950 remains at the forefront, driving innovation and enabling organizations to harness the full potential of their data.